Surinaamse Amandel Orgeade

Cultural Context

Originating from the rich culinary traditions of Suriname, Amandel Orgeade is a beloved beverage that reflects the country's diverse influences, including African, Indian, and Dutch. Traditionally enjoyed during celebrations and family gatherings, this sweet almond drink is cherished for its creamy texture and refreshing taste. In modern times, it has gained popularity beyond Suriname, often found in Caribbean festivals and among those seeking unique, flavorful beverages.

1

Soak both sweet and bitter almonds in hot water for 5 to 10 minutes.

2

Peel the skin off the sweet almonds after soaking.

3

Rinse and drain the peeled sweet almonds.

4

Combine both the bitter and sweet almonds in a bowl.

5

Blend the almonds in a blender until smooth.

6

Pour the blended almond mixture into a pot.

7

Add sugar to the pot and bring the mixture to a boil to create a thick syrup.

8

Dilute the syrup with water to taste.
